Gender Equality Bill to be fine-tuned – Masi Garba

The Chairman, Senate Committee on Tertiary Institutions and TETFund, Senator Binta Masi Garba, has said the senate did not jettison the proposed gender equality bill but that there were areas that needed to be fine-tuned.
Garba said the bill would be fine-tuned in such a way it would not conflict with religious beliefs in the country.
She was speaking in Abuja at a workshop for the Development of Benchmark Minimum Academics Standards (BMAS) for Gender and Transformation Leadership (GLT) as a general study course for Nigerian universities.
She added that they had discussed giving  women equal inheritance right as enshrined in the Bible and Koran.
“We looked at gender parity instead of looking for equality which obviously, men are running away from,” she said.
Speaking on Gender and Transformation Leadership as a course for Nigerian universities, she said  universities shouldn’t have problem with the development of the benchmark for gender studies because parents had been encouraging their children to go to school irrespective of their gender.
